Second Cup Café at 145 King St W, Toronto, stands out as a sanctuary for coffee enthusiasts seeking both quality and comfort in the heart of downtown. This well-loved coffee shop offers more than just expertly brewed beverages – it delivers an inviting atmosphere characterized by big, airy spaces flooded with natural light from expansive windows, creating a serene backdrop whether you're working, catching up with friends, or simply savoring a moment of calm.
Customers frequently praise the exceptional service here, highlighting the baristas’ genuine care and creativity. One reviewer shared how the barista patiently crafted a unique strawberry and lavender frocho along with a rich caramel corretto, underscoring the staff’s willingness to customize drinks and accommodate particular tastes. This personalized approach amplifies the café's warmth and charm, making every visit feel special.
The coffee itself is nothing short of consistently excellent. Loyal patrons have applauded the bold, flavorful brews that awaken the senses with delightful aromas, perfectly setting the tone for a busy day in Toronto. The flat white here is served piping hot, reflecting the team’s attention to detail and commitment to quality. Alongside your coffee, you can indulge in tempting snacks such as the decadent millionaire bar, which perfectly complements the rich drinks and leaves a memorable impression on the palate.
Beyond the beverages, the café’s spacious layout includes comfy lounge chairs and numerous little tables, suitable for work or casual meetings, though some users note that the bright light might cause screen glare – a small concession for the vibrant, energizing ambiance. Free, reliable Wi-Fi further enhances the experience, making this location a favored spot among freelancers and remote workers.
Ordering through the app is seamless and efficient, with staff ready to offer insightful suggestions – like additional details about the white hot chocolate powder – ensuring every choice satisfies. Patrons repeatedly express a desire to return, drawn by the combination of welcoming service, high-quality coffee, and the soothing quietness that’s often elusive in a bustling downtown area.
